What Does Information Technology Do?

In today’s fast-paced, interconnected world, information technology (IT) is pivotal in shaping how we live, work, and communicate. It’s not just a department in a company; it’s a dynamic field that influences almost every aspect of our daily lives. But what exactly does information technology do? In this blog post, we’ll delve into IT to uncover its functions and how it impacts our world.

Understanding Information Technology:

Before we dive into what IT does, let’s clarify what information technology is. Information technology uses computers, software, networks, and electronic systems to store, process, transmit, and retrieve information. It encompasses a broad spectrum of activities and technologies, each serving a specific purpose in the modern digital landscape.

1. Data Management and Storage:

One of the fundamental roles of IT is data management and storage. IT professionals design and maintain databases and storage systems that securely store vast amounts of data. This data can include anything from customer information to financial records and product inventories.

2. Communication and Networking:

It is the backbone of modern communication. It’s responsible for creating and managing networks that enable global data and information exchange. This includes establishing and maintaining the internet, intranets, and local area networks (LANs) within organizations.

3. Software Development and Maintenance:

Software development is a core function of IT. IT professionals write, test, and maintain software applications in various industries and sectors. This includes everything from operating systems and productivity tools to mobile apps and specialized software for specific industries.

4. Cybersecurity:

With the increasing threat of cyberattacks, IT plays a critical role in cybersecurity. IT experts implement security measures to protect sensitive data, networks, and systems from hackers, viruses, and malicious entities.

5. IT Support and Helpdesk:

IT professionals provide support and assistance to end-users. They troubleshoot hardware and software issues, configure devices, and ensure that technology runs smoothly within an organization.

6. Business Process Optimization:

It is also instrumental in streamlining business operations. Through automation, data analysis, and process optimization, IT helps organizations become more efficient and competitive in their respective industries.

7. Research and Development:

The IT sector is continually evolving. Research and development are essential to create innovative technologies and solutions that meet the changing needs of businesses and individuals.

8. Education and Training:

IT professionals often play a role in educating others about technology. They may train employees, students, or the general public to enhance digital literacy and skills.
